Role Overview:
We are looking for a dedicated and efficient Kitchen Assistant to join our team. In this role, you will help prepare and serve a variety of menu items, including pizzas, hot dogs, nachos, chips, burgers etc... The ideal candidate will have a passion for food, strong organisational skills, and the ability to work in a fast-paced kitchen environment.
Key Responsibilities:
- Food Preparation: Assist in the preparation and assembly of pizzas, hot dogs, nachos, chips, burgers etc.. Following standard recipes and portion control guidelines.
- Cooking and Assembly: Help with cooking and assembling menu items, ensuring that food is cooked to the correct specifications and served at the right temperature.
- Quality Control: Ensure that all food served meets the highest standards of quality, taste, and presentation.
- Stock Management: Monitor ingredient levels and notify the kitchen supervisor when supplies are running low. Assist with receiving deliveries and storing stock efficiently.
- Kitchen Cleanliness: Maintain a clean and organized work area, including prepping stations, cooking surfaces, and kitchen equipment. Adhere to strict hygiene and health and safety standards.
- Weekly Kitchen Deep Clean: Participate in a weekly team responsibility of deep cleaning the entire kitchen area, including all equipment, surfaces, and storage areas, ensuring the kitchen meets high cleanliness standards.
- Food Safety Compliance: Follow food safety guidelines, including proper food handling, storage, and sanitation procedures.
- Assisting Kitchen Staff: Work closely with chefs and other kitchen staff to support the smooth running of kitchen operations. Assist in any other tasks as directed by the Kitchen Manager or Supervisor.
- Customer Service: Occasionally assist in serving food to customers when necessary and ensure customer satisfaction by providing accurate and timely orders.
- Prep and Close Down: Assist with opening and closing procedures, including prepping ingredients for the next shift and ensuring the kitchen is cleaned and sanitized at the end of the day.
Skills and Qualifications:
- Previous kitchen or food preparation experience is preferred, but not essential.
- 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ced environment.
- Strong attention to detail and a commitment to high-quality food preparation.
- Excellent organizational and time management skills.
- Good communication skills and the ability to work as part of a team.
- Knowledge of food safety and hygiene practices.
- Ability to work flexible hours, including evenings, weekends, and holidays.
